Coming to Bristol: owls, hawks, eagles and more
BRISTOL -- The fifth annual raptor weekend will be held tomorrow and Sunday at the Audubon Society's Environmental Education Center.
Owls, hawks, eagles, falcons and other birds of prey will be there.
The center is at 1401 Hope St. and the event runs each day from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m.
Admission is $12 for adults, $6 for children age 4 to 12.
For information, call (401) 245-7500.
